Transaction 17da4e602fe5916e8fe3bc54782778c127b8e2fb0aae55b9d36e42d41d544aac

12 Input
2 Outputs
  • 17da4e602fe5916e8fe3bc54782778c127b8e2fb0aae55b9d36e42d41d544aac:0
  • value  4900000
    address  34EGLSxhXWLoEW388xCwDqJGvwuBijFPN7
  • 17da4e602fe5916e8fe3bc54782778c127b8e2fb0aae55b9d36e42d41d544aac:1
  • value  13944542
    address  3NA1q2iDsZrH3qQE9N8G9SyrRgZMXXm1HT